§ 14-09-36 — Death of a child - Duty to report - Penalty

Text
1.A caretaker of a child in the caretaker's care is guilty of a class C felony if the caretaker
willfully fails to:
a.Report the child's death to a law enforcement agency within two hours after
learning about the child's death; or
b.Report the location of the child's corpse to a law enforcement agency within two
hours after learning the location of the corpse.
2.This section does not apply to the death of a child which occurs while the child is
under the care of a health care professional or emergency medical personnel.
